459 FZUS63 KDTX 100238 GLFLH Open Lake Forecast for Lake Huron National Weather Service Detroit/Pontiac MI 938 PM EST Sun Nov 9 2025 For waters beyond five nautical miles off shore on Lake Huron Waves are the significant wave height - the average of the highest 1/3 of the wave spectrum. Occasional wave height is the average of the highest 1/10 of the wave spectrum. .SYNOPSIS...Broad low pressure tracks into New England tonight with a trailing surface trough pivoting across the southern Great Lakes. This system ushers in an arctic air mass with gusty north to northwest flow and snow showers through the early week. Gusty southwest flow follows on Tuesday as milder air arrives, then the next cold front passes through the Great Lakes on Wednesday. There is a low probability for gales on Tuesday and a moderate probability on Wednesday and Thursday.
